July 31, 200916 yr does Memory on a Video card matter for FSX I have seen that the new video cards most have ddr5 now.Yes.. amount, bus and clock in memory all mattersNo need to exceed 1GB, greater than 512 is good but greater than 1024 is not going to net anything unless a large number of monitors are in use and then it will only help with panning, not performance in the way of frames or smoothThe memory chip type is only going to help if the card is truly taking advantage of it within its core design. Right now the best card for FSX and higher quality procs/higher clocks is the GTX 285 1GB. The 2GB model can present small advantages to multimonitor setups but past that not worth the price or use in FSXCore clock is more important than memory clock however both do supply a better result. The higher the core and memory speed on the card selected, without becoming unstable or overheating, the better
